Our next Alpha Course starts on 30th January.
We run a six week Alpha Course at Holy Trinity, covering many crucial questions of the Christian faith.
Who is Jesus? Why did Jesus die on the Cross? Did Jesus rise from the Dead? Can I trust the Bible? How should I pray? and Why do bad things happen to good people?
a few weeks after our six week course, we come back together for a reunion evening, when we explore what it means to be filled with the Holy Spirit.
Typical comments on the course include:
“totally transformative”
“underpinned my faith”
“I feel much better grounded in what I believe”
Each evening begins at 7pm with gathering and nibbles, followed by a meal together, a talk, and small groups for discussion.
